Where to find index buckets and their max size?

We want to take a look at our bucket sizes to see if they are rolling too quickly due to thier size. I assume in the _internal index there is some jucy tidbits of into about buckets. Any help is MUCH apprecaiated.

For seeing the current size of buckets I use dbinspect

|dbinspect index=indexName

The default maxDataSize is 750mb if not specifically set in indexes.conf.

Warm buckets might be a bit larger due to post processing and buckets might be smaller if data is sparse or Splunk is restarted before the hot buckets fill to 750mb.
